Normal Evergreen Senescence vs. Problematic Browning

To effectively diagnose the issue, it is essential to distinguish between natural aging and pathological decline. Evergreens, unlike their deciduous counterparts, retain their needles for multiple years. However, these needles do not last forever. It is entirely normal for older needles on the interior or lower branches to yellow or turn brown before dropping off in the fall. This process is typically gradual and affects only a small portion of the treeโs canopy.
Identifying Abnormal Symptoms

You should be concerned if the browning is rapid, affects the upper or terminal growth, or appears on the new shoots. In healthy evergreens, the current seasonโs growth should remain vibrant green. The presence of brown needles on the outside or tips of branches is a clear visual indicator that the tree is struggling to maintain its foliage. This specific symptom often points to environmental stress rather than simple aging.
Environmental and Cultural Stressors

One of the most common reasons for evergreen tree leaves turning brown in the fall is drought stress. These trees require consistent moisture, especially as they prepare for winter. If the summer was particularly dry or if the tree is planted in sandy, fast-draining soil, it may not have retained enough water to sustain the needles through the cooler months. The browning is often a defense mechanism to conserve water, but it leaves the tree vulnerable.
Winter Burn is another prevalent culprit, particularly for species like Boxwood or Yew. This occurs when the harsh winds of winter dehydrate the foliage faster than the roots can absorb water from the frozen ground. The result is desiccation, where the leaves appear bleached or scorched, turning a rusty brown. This is frequently mistaken for frost damage, but the injury is actually caused by the drying wind rather than the cold temperature itself.
Soil and Root Complications

Problems below the ground can manifest as browning above. Compacted soil, poor drainage, or high soil salinity can restrict root growth and prevent the tree from accessing necessary nutrients. If the roots are damaged or suffocated, the tree cannot uptake water efficiently, leading to premature needle drop and browning. Additionally, the application of lawn fertilizer too close to the tree trunk can create a toxic burn that travels through the vascular system to the foliage.

Pathological and Biological Factors

While environmental causes are common, fungal and bacterial diseases can also lead to browning. Root rot, caused by pathogens like *Phytophthora*, thrives in wet, poorly drained soils. The infection attacks the roots, cutting off the water supply to the needles. Homeowners often notice the browning appears suddenly and is accompanied with a general decline in the tree's vigor, even if the soil moisture seems adequate.
Insect infestations should not be overlooked when investigating why evergreen tree leaves turning brown in the fall. Although many pests are more active in summer, certain species, like spider mites, become problematic during the hot, dry days of late summer, causing stippling and bronzing that progresses to browning. Inspecting the undersides of the needles for webbing or tiny moving dots is a critical step in confirming a biological culprit.
